A new physics teacher faces a daunting task. All too frequently he or she is asked to teach physics without the benefit of sufficient background in either the content or pedagogy of physics. Yet, obtaining that background information is not easy for an in-service, under-prepared teacher. The Physics Teaching Web Advisory (Pathway) is addressing this problem by creating a dynamic digital library for physics teaching. This library provides information which can help teachers of all levels of proficiency prepare for their classes including a large corpus of virtual video laboratories and demonstrations that emphasize hands-on and mindson activities as well as conceptual understanding of the physics. Pathway is integrated with a novel system by which users can easily obtain valuable assistance through interactions with live and virtual experts in the field. To make these materials accessible Pathway includes state-of-the-art video retrieval tools. Pathway builds on the Informedia Digital Video Library, which is addressing the problem of information extraction from video and audio content, and Synthetic Interviews of expert physics teachers, with pedagogical advances developed at Kansas State University and with materials contributed by master teachers. The Synthetic Interview is a technology and technique that creates an anthropomorphic interface into video of a person responding to questions and has been successfully used by Carnegie Mellon researchers in numerous other domains. With Synthetic Interviews developed for Pathway, the new-to-physics teachers, pre-service teachers, and experienced teachers will be able to “converse” with knowledgeable experts on their classroom techniques and how those techniques are related to contemporary issues in physics teaching Pathway builds on a unique collaboration between several longstanding research projects in digital video libraries, advanced distance learning technologies, collaboration technologies, and nationally known experts in physics pedagogy and high quality content. The result is a state-of-the-art system in which all users interact, both virtually and directly, with experts in physics teaching to become more effective teachers of physics.
